I had the same problem. When you open the lan world it should say something like "Opened a world on port xxxxx". Go to a command prompt and type in "ipconfig /all" without the quotes and get your local ip address. Then on minecraft click direct connect and type in your local ip and port. It would look like this: 192.168.1.195:55265. the direct conect worked for me.

We have figured out how to get around it.
He just need to put your Ip into direct contact.
To find your Ip you just have to search for 'cmd' and a black box should open.
Then type 'ipconfig' into the black box.
A bunch of stuff will come up, you are looking for the ipv4 address.
